Roast Pork, Cranberry and Apple

Serves: 4-6

 

Ingredients:

  • 1kg Deboned Leg of Pork
  • 1 KNORR Rosemary and Garlic Cook-in-Bag
  • 1 Onion chopped
  • 1 Apple cored & sliced (skin on)
  • 2 Tbsp. Cranberry sauce
  • 1 Tbsp. Honey
  • 50ml cold water

 Method:

  1. Preheat oven to 180C
  2. Place sliced apples and onion in the bag
  3. Place 1kg deboned pork leg in the roasting bag
  4. Sprinkle seasoning mix over the pork
  5. Add the cranberry sauce, honey and 50ml cold water
  6. Seal the bag with the tie provided
  7. Roll gently to coat the pork evenly
  8. Pierce the top of the bag 3 times with a sharp knife for the steam to escape.
  9. Roast for an hour, then open the bag and roast for a further 15 minutes to brown the surface.
  10. Serve with roast potatoes, Yorkshire pudding, glazed carrots, cranberry & apple sauces
